Default Cleartastic?

just curious if anyone uses this product? seems easier to put on yourself then the 3m? i gotta do something for the rock chips down the side of the car (z06). thanks for any info if someone uses it.

I have had it on my car for two years I followed the detailed directions and has not peeled off which is the main complaint with it..
Last summer I drove thru something and splashed on car, long story short Cleartastic pc protected the car, it did stain the pc of Cleartastic which looked bad but better than cars finish... I bought another kit this spring when one of the forum vendors had a great sale and replaced the stained pc which was really a eye sore since it was dark and I have a V Yellow C6... Needless to say I would recomend it but only my 2 cents.

had it on my C3 for about a year...turned yellow around the edges and got crusty...but I was driving alot during the summer I had it on. Protected very well...couldn't see it either.
